Within these pages lie three tales, each a shard of the human experience. In "A Simple Heart," unwavering devotion clashes with a life of hardship. "The Legend of Saint Julian" chills with a descent into darkness, where redemption may lurk in the most unexpected guise. Finally, "Herodias" unveils the intoxicating allure and dreadful cost of a single, fateful dance. Prepare to be swept away by Gustave Flaubert's masterful prose, where beauty and brutality intertwine, leaving you questioning faith, forgiveness, and the very essence of humanity.

Author

Gustave Flaubert

Gustave Flaubert was born in Rouen in 1821. He initially studied to become a lawyer, but gave it up after a bout of ill-health, and devoted himself to writing. After travelling extensively, and working on many unpublished projects, he completed Madame Bovary in 1856. This was published to great scandal and acclaim, and Flaubert became a celebrated literary figure. His reputation was cemented with Salammbô (1862) and Sentimental Education (1869). He died in 1880, probably of a stroke, leaving his last work, Bouvard et Pécuchet, unfinished.
